What is the 15th term in the arithmetic sequence described by this explicit formula?
an= 63 +(n-1)(-7)

To find the 15th term of the arithmetic sequence described by the explicit formula \( a_n = 63 + (n - 1)(-7) \), we need to substitute \( n = 15 \) into the formula.
\[
a_{15} = 63 + (15 - 1)(-7)
\]
Calculating the expression step by step:
1. Calculate \( 15 - 1 \):
\[
15 - 1 = 14
\]
2. Now, calculate \( 14 \times -7 \):
\[
14 \times -7 = -98
\]
3. Now substitute back into the formula:
\[
a_{15} = 63 + (-98)
\]
4. Now perform the addition:
\[
a_{15} = 63 - 98 = -35
\]
Therefore, the 15th term of the sequence is \(\boxed{-35}\).
